Primary Duties and Responsibilities (details of the basic job functions) :

Provide consultative services, support and assistance with the recruitment and screening of Entrepreneurial Agent candidates across the company.

Participate in the development of recruiting strategies, utilizing various screening techniques to including the development of candidate profiles, identification of comprehensive screening criteria, etc.

Conduct preliminary interviews, administer tests, conduct background checks and validate capital to ensure appropriate financing to start business.

Assist management in the development of a corporate appointment plan and develop and manages the EA recruitment budget. Develop selection instruments to assist in the hiring process and identify selection objectives, time lines and evaluate alternatives to present to management.

Work to build a qualified candidate pool that supports corporate objectives. Coordinate pre-employment activities to include candidate reference and background checks in accordance with EEO guidelines, federal and state laws / regulations and established company EA guidelines.

Work with various departments (e.g. Legal, Human Resources, Underwriting, Corporate Education, etc.) to complete the hiring process and integrates hiring activities and resources with other company initiatives.

Assist sales force in resolving problems relative to recruitment needs and provides status reports to management regarding hiring efforts.

Who We Are

Become a part of something bigger.

The Auto Club Group (ACG) provides membership, travel, insurance, and financial service offerings to approximately 14+ million members and customers across 14 states and 2 U.

S. territories through AAA, Meemic, and Fremont brands. ACG belongs to the national AAA federation and is the second largest AAA club in North America.

By continuing to invest in more advanced technology, pursuing innovative products, and hiring a highly skilled workforce, AAA continues to build upon its heritage of providing quality service and helping our members enjoy life's journey through insurance, travel, financial services, and roadside assistance.
